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Pevensey Bay to Crosskeys start from as little as £28.00

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Pevensey Bay to Crosskeys start from £104.40 one way, or £105.40 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Pevensey Bay to Crosskeys are available for £149.50 one way, or £299.00 return

Split ticketing means that instead of purchasing one rail ticket for your journey we automatically find and help you book two or more tickets instead, covering exactly the same journey. We call it our FairSplit.

Facilities and Comfort at Your Fingertips

At Pevensey Bay, you'll find facilities thoughtfully designed for ease and accessibility. The station may lack a traditional ticket office, but rest assured, modern ticket machines are ready for your convenience—enabling both ticket collections and purchases. Importantly, these machines accommodate Disabled Persons Railcard discounts, ensuring inclusive travel. For anyone requiring additional help, customer help points are situated on platforms, offering a touch of human assistance when you need it.

While the station has no staff assistance, thoughtful features like induction loops and accessible ticket machines facilitate an accommodating environment. It's worth noting, however, that step-free access is available only on parts of the station, achieved through ramps and level crossings. Facilities and Amenities

At Crosskeys station, there isn't a traditional ticket office, but rest assured, purchasing tickets is straightforward with accessible ticket machines available. These machines accept cash as well as major debit and credit cards, providing a smooth transaction experience. For those collecting tickets purchased online, the process is seamless at the station machines.

While the station doesn’t have ample amenities like shops or lounges, it offers essential facilities like seating areas and departure screens to keep travelers informed. Accessibility is partially catered for with step-free access to platforms available, though the absence of accessible toilets should be noted for those who might require them. Security is considered too, with CCTV in operation at the station.

Onward Travel from Crosskeys

The station's strategic location ensures connectivity beyond its platforms. For moments when rail services are interrupted, a rail replacement bus service is conveniently accessible on Risca Road. Despite the lack of cycle hire facilities, cycling enthusiasts can make use of the bicycle lockers available close to the southbound platform. While taxis and car hires are not directly available at the station, local options can be explored nearby to continue your journey.
